Aarson is slightly better... So, Aarson. Aarson stands for Aaron and Jackson, which was an amazingly beautiful lovestory in Emmerdale which started in 2010. Unfortunately it ended as early as 2011.

Danny Miller as Aaron Livesy.

So, in 2008 Danny Miller took over the part of Aaron Livesy after Danny Webb who had been playing the part 2003-2006. Aaron was a really troubled teenager back then. Now he is a quite troubled 20-something guy instead. Aaron dated a few girls, but eventually we started suspecting that he really preferred guys instead. He had a small crush on his best friend Adam Barton (who is played by his real life best friend Adam Thomas) and then eventually he met Jackson Walsh.

Marc Silcock.

Jackson Walsh was played by Marc Silcock who actually already had been playing a part in Emmerdale once before. In 2001 Marc Silcock played Bob Hope's son Josh for a few episodes, and then later for another few episodes in 2006. And this is really hilarious. But I guess he made a really good job and was really well liked by the Emmerdale crew since they wanted him back. Marc Silcock also played a small part in Hollyoaks 2008-2009, where he looked exactly the same as Jackson I think.

Anyhow, Aaron was deep deep down in the closet when he met Jackson and he beated both him and Paddy up to keep his secret, which was really painful to watch. But eventually he gave in and Aaron and Jackson became an itemn. But it was never a walk in the park anyway. Aaron had lots and lots of anger within, and the relationship was crumbelling.The fact that Jackson was in a terrible accident did not really make it easier.

Jackson is left paralyzed from the shoulders down and now the real agony begins. Let's just say: jackson will die and Aaron's deepest and darkest feelings will show by self harm and lots and lots of guilt. If you have seen the Robron storyline you will have seen examples of it.
